What Is a Quick Cable Resistance Tester?


A quick cable resistance tester is an electronic device used to evaluate the resistance of electrical cables and connections. It employs a direct current (DC) method to apply a known voltage across the cable and then measures the resulting current. The resistance is calculated using Ohm's law, providing instantaneous and reliable readings. This tool is pivotal in identifying issues such as corrosion, poor connections, or insulation breakdown that may lead to electrical failures.

Advancements in Technology


As technology evolves, so do quick cable resistance testers. Factories are continually updating their manufacturing processes and the devices themselves to incorporate the latest advancements. Features such as digital displays, data logging capabilities, and Bluetooth connectivity are becoming standard in modern testers. These innovations not only enhance user experience but also improve the accuracy and functionality of the devices.


The integration of software applications has also revolutionized how data from these testers is utilized. Users can now easily analyze and interpret resistance readings, track changes over time, and generate comprehensive reports. Such capabilities are invaluable for maintenance teams in identifying trends and initiating preventative measures.
